Auto Parts with Aisin & Radiator in Jamaica

Show Filters

  Filter 2 Auto Parts with Aisin & Radiator in Jamaica  
Auto Parts x
Aisin x
Radiator x
Used x
Home   >   Auto Parts in Jamaica

2 Auto Parts with Aisin & Radiator found in Jamaica